Written by MIKE CAREY
Penciled by CHRIS BACHALO
Cover by DAVID FINCH
Variant Cover by SIMONE BIANCHI
MESSIAH COMPLEX Part 9 Layla Miller and Madrox make a startling discovery but their chances of escape appear bleak. The hunt for the baby continues as the casualties mount and a shocking turn of events reveals a traitor!

"If you’re anything like me (please God, no) you’ve no doubt been reading the current Messiah CompleX event and thinking, “Yes, yes, all this action and adventure is well and good, but can’t I read about a futuristic internment camp as well?” Well, you can this week, as Mike Carey salvages the to-date pointless ‘Jamie and Layla in the future’ sub-plot with a truly chilling emphasis on bleakness and more bleakness, tossing in a little dash of dread to make it something special. All this, plus spill-over from last week’s epic tussle, the New X-Men continue to inexplicably contribute to the story, and an X-Man maybe sort-of is a traitor. And someone maybe sort-of dies. Find out next week, I guess."

THIS BOOK GETS 9 GRAHAMS OUT OF 10
